delphi书籍集锦

《Delphi书籍集锦》是专为DELPHI爱好者精心整理的一套经典教材,它涵盖了从初学者到高级开发者所需的各种知识,旨在帮助读者全面掌握Delphi编程技术。Delphi,作为一款强大的对象Pascal编程环境,因其高效、直观的特性在软件开发领域备受推崇。下面将对这套书籍中的关键知识点进行详细的阐述。 1. **对象Pascal语言**:Delphi的核心是基于Pascal语言的,它扩展了标准Pascal,引入了面向对象的概念,如类、继承、多态和接口。理解这些概念是学习Delphi的基础。 2. **VCL框架**:Visual Component Library(VCL)是Delphi用于构建用户界面的组件库,包含了大量的预定义控件和类。学习如何使用VCL创建美观、功能丰富的应用程序是Delphi开发的关键。 3. **RAD(快速应用开发)**:Delphi引入了RAD工具,允许开发者快速地构建和部署应用程序。了解如何利用RAD理念提高开发效率是Delphi编程的重要技能。 4. **数据库集成**:Delphi提供了强大的数据库支持,如ADO(ActiveX Data Objects)、BDE(Borland Database Engine)和FireDAC。学习如何连接和操作各种数据库,如SQL Server、Oracle和MySQL,是Delphi应用程序开发中的常见任务。 5. **网络编程**:Delphi支持Internet应用程序的开发,如HTTP、FTP、SMTP等协议。理解和运用这些技术可以创建网络服务、客户端应用程序等。 6. **单元测试与调试**:Delphi提供了集成的单元测试框架,如DUnit和TestComplete,以及强大的调试工具。熟练掌握单元测试和调试技巧能确保代码质量。 7. **图形处理与多媒体**:Delphi支持GDI+和DirectX,使得开发者能够处理图像、音频和视频。了解如何利用这些库进行图形和多媒体开发,可以为应用程序增添丰富功能。 8. **多线程与并发**:Delphi提供了强大的多线程支持,使开发者可以构建高性能、响应迅速的应用程序。理解线程管理、同步和并发原则是优化程序性能的关键。 9. **国际化与本地化**:Delphi提供了工具和API来支持软件的国际化和本地化,使应用程序能够适应不同地区和语言的需求。 10. **组件开发**:学习如何创建自定义组件,可以扩展Delphi的功能并实现特定需求。了解组件设计原则和实现方法是提升开发能力的重要步骤。 11. **移动与跨平台开发**:随着FireMonkey (FMX)的引入,Delphi开发者可以创建能在多个操作系统上运行的应用,包括iOS、Android、Windows和macOS。 12. **设计模式**:理解并应用设计模式,如工厂模式、单例模式、观察者模式等,有助于编写可维护、可扩展的代码。这套《Delphi书籍集锦》不仅涵盖了以上知识点,还可能包括实际案例分析、项目实践和调试技巧等内容,为读者提供了全面而深入的学习资源。通过系统学习,读者可以成为熟练的Delphi开发者,创造出高效、专业的应用程序。
rar
技巧集.rar 预估大小:15个文件
folder
技巧集 文件夹
file
在Windows XP中共享上网1.wps 1.07MB
file
about_box.txt 755B
file
email.txt 11KB
file
Delphi 编程技巧.txt 982B
file
Excel2003函数应用完全手册.pdf 1.03MB
file
用delphi4的qreport部件2.wps 128KB
file
delphi3如何调用excel.wps 35KB
file
用delphi4的qreport部件12.wps 128KB
file
intel cpu新编号全接触.wps 39KB
file
用delphi4的qreport部件1.wps 134KB
file
照片偏白怎么办.wps 104KB
file
delphi3如何调用excel2.wps 35KB
file
照片偏白怎么办2.wps 104KB
file
ActiveX组件及其注册.txt 7KB
file
win2003的配置.wps 202KB
rar 文件大小:2.18MB